We have the AA answering all inbound calls and routing to hunt groups now. Calls end up ringing for a bit sometimes before they are answered.

My ideal solution would be to setup extensions in a Calling Group, but I have certain users that don't really want to be the primary to answer things like customer service calls, but they could answer if the call continued to ring.

So the question is: Is there ANY way to assign a lighted button that lights up when it's the Call Group ringing the user's phone as opposed to a DIRECT call to their extension? I'm guessing no, but it's worth asking.....it would be such a huge benefit to our call management.

Thanks!
 
If you have a spare line port and a spare ext. port you could loop the 2 together with a line cord and then add the spare ext. port to your calling group. Program a line (spare line port #) button on the exts. that need the light and then turn off the ringing for that line, so when the calling group is called the line button will light up to identify a calling group call. I have done this in the past and it works really well. Good luck.
 
Wow, that's so simple it's brilliant.

How exactly do I wire the line port to the extension? Just a standard cable?
 
Just a single pair line cord will do it, plug one end into your spare line port and the other end into your spare ext. port.
